C++ guidelines

Run the linter before claiming a change is done: python apps/codestyle/codestyle-cpp.py

Code style

Hard rules (also enforced by CI with -Werror, plus cppcheck):

  • Allman braces. No braces around single-line statements. if (x) — never if(x) or if ( x ).
  • auto const& (not const auto&); Type const* (not const Type*).
  • Use {} format specifiers (fmt-style), not %u/%s.
  • Use the typed helpers, not raw flag access:
    • IsPlayer(), IsCreature(), IsItem(), … instead of GetTypeId() == TYPEID_*.
    • GetNpcFlags(), HasNpcFlag(), SetNpcFlag(), RemoveNpcFlag(), ReplaceAllNpcFlags() instead of *Flag(UNIT_NPC_FLAGS, …).
    • IsRefundable(), IsBOPTradable(), IsWrapped() instead of HasFlag(ITEM_FIELD_FLAGS, …).
    • HasFlag(ItemFlag) / HasFlag2(ItemFlag2) / HasFlagCu(ItemFlagsCustom) instead of bitwise Flags & ITEM_FLAG….
    • ObjectGuid::ToString().c_str() instead of ObjectGuid::GetCounter().

Project conventions

  • Logging: LOG_INFO("category.sub", "msg with {}", arg) (also LOG_WARN/ERROR/DEBUG/TRACE). Categories are hierarchical, dot-separated (server.loading, entities.player, sql.dev). No printf-style, no sLog->, no TC_LOG_*. Macro in src/common/Logging/Log.h.
  • Random: use helpers in src/common/Utilities/Random.hurand, irand, frand, rand32, rand_chance, roll_chance_f, roll_chance_i. Not std::rand or <random>.
  • Strings: Acore::StringFormat(fmt, args...) ({} placeholders) — src/common/Utilities/StringFormat.h.
  • Config: sConfigMgr->GetOption<T>("Name", default) — read once at startup/reload and cache the value; never call it in hot paths or per-call gating checks.
  • Namespace: project-wide Acore:: (no Trinity:: remnants — rename when porting from upstream forks).
  • Long-lived references: don't store a raw Player* / Creature* / Unit* past the current call/tick — the object can be removed (logout, despawn, instance unload) and the pointer dangles. Store the ObjectGuid and resolve at use time via ObjectAccessor::FindPlayer(guid), Map::GetCreature(guid), etc.
  • DB queries: use PreparedStatement (via WorldDatabase / CharacterDatabase / LoginDatabase and the prepared-statement enums), not raw query strings. Non-blocking reads go async: _queryProcessor.AddCallback(db.AsyncQuery(stmt).WithPreparedCallback(...)) (or WithCallback). Multi-statement writes wrap in SQLTransaction + Execute / AppendPreparedStatement.
  • Timed actions in AI: use EventMap (event id → delay; simple) or TaskScheduler (lambdas, repeats, cancellation), both members of CreatureAI — don't roll your own tick counters. See any boss script under src/server/scripts/.
